Unauthorized email relay via unauthenticated sendfiles endpoint
Published Aug 27, 2026 · Updated Aug 27, 2026
Incorrect access control in Veno File Manager 4.4.9 allows remote attackers to send email through the application's configured SMTP server. The /vfm-admin/ajax/sendfiles.php endpoint accepts attacker-supplied POST parameters and a required header, then invokes the configured mail transport without enforcing authentication. Network access to the endpoint and a configured SMTP server are required; successful requests cause unauthorized email delivery through that server.
